Universal entanglement of typical states in constrained systems
ORAL
Abstract
We develop a formalism to exactly evaluate the bipartite entanglement of random states in large Hilbert spaces with local and global constraints. We solve the simplest class of constraints which includes the much studied Rydberg-blockaded/Fibonacci chain. The resulting entanglement spectra may be classified into `phases’ depending on their singularities. Our results predict the entanglement of infinite temperature eigenstates in thermalizing constrained systems and provide a baseline for numerical studies.
